With the latest update on the legendary singer SP Balasubramaniam from MGM hospital, it seems like his condition is a big concern as he is on Extracorporeal Membrane Oxygenation (ECMO) support.

The singer was admitted to hospital last week after he was diagnosed with COVID-19.

As per a report, a health update from the hospital says, the legendary singer who was on ventilator is now on ECMO support and continues to remain in ICU.

Although his son has recently asked the media and public to stop spreading fake news and rumours on SPB's health, latest reports suggest that the singer’s health continues to be a matter of concern.

SPB is a multilingual singer and has sung over 40,000 songs across all the languages in South India and also in Hindi.  In all, he is credited with singing in 16 languages.
